Problem overview

Some Dodge Magnum owners report experiencing issues with the vehicle speed sensors, which can lead to a malfunctioning speedometer. Common causes include a faulty vehicle speed sensor (VSS), a defective speedometer, or underlying electrical issues. Error codes such as P0501 may indicate problems with the VSS, while a check engine light often accompanies a faulty speed sensor, triggering trouble codes like P0500. To diagnose these issues, owners are advised to use an OBD-II scanner to check for error codes related to the speedometer or VSS. Additionally, fault code P0501 could result from various factors, including problems with the sensor harness, poor electrical connections, or a malfunctioning Engine Control Module (ECM). It is recommended that owners investigate these components to effectively address and resolve any speed sensor-related problems.
